It's Vintage, daahling

(menu)

Destination - VINTAGE_-_THE_PEOPLE_5.jpgIf you happen to be in Northamptonshire in a month’s time, you may happen across a country house full of hippies, flappers and ravers. Fear not, for this is not some tired old fancy dress party full of cheese and pineapple sticks, but the Vintage Festival – a celebration of all the top trends through the decades.

Started by Wayne and Gerardine Hemingway, co-founders of fashion label Red or Dead, Vintage Festival is a weekend featuring the best sartorial, design and culinary delights from the 1920s through to the 1980s.

There will be fashion shows curated by Twiggy and Jo Wood, a celebration of Sir Peter Blake’s (the man behind the Beatles’ Sgt. Pepper’s Lonely Hearts Club Band album artwork) 80th and ‘make do and mend’ classes.Destination - VINTAGE_-_THE_PEOPLE_3.jpg

Musically, it’s a suitably mixed bag, with a series of nightclubs dedicated to different decades. They’ll include performances swinging from the infectious disco of Chic featuring Nile Rodgers through to the punk rock of The Damned, while the heady days of the rave scene will be relived with Danny Rampling and former Hacienda resident Graeme Park.

Destination - claire_clark_1.jpgOne not to be missed is the vintage tea experience, which has been dreamt up by Claire Clark MBE (pictured, left), former head pastry chef at The French Laundry. Square Meal has been lucky enough to be privy to a preview, which includes coronation chicken sandwiches, marmalade macaroons and rose-and-raspberry meringues.

So get those platforms on and get down for the most eclectic, eccentric country-house party of the year.

The Vintage Festival will take place on 13-15 July at Boughton House, Northamptonshire. Visit the website for tickets and more information.
